A solar combiner box is a crucial component in solar energy systems, designed to consolidate the outputs of multiple solar panel strings into a single output that connects to an inverter. Without it, wiring becomes tangled, voltage drops occur, maintenance costs rise, and safety risks increase. Plane of Array Irradiance, the sum of direct, diffuse, and ground-reflected irradiance incident upon an inclined surface parallel to the plane of the modules in the photovoltaic array, also known as POA Irradiance and expressed in units of W/m2. Data are collected over a period of a year, stored locally in a database and made available in real time over a secure internet connection.
